Answer to Question 2

Attorneys generally are not allowed to represent parties if that representation would result in a conflict of interest. A conflict of interest occurs when the attorney cannot give all of his or her loyalty to the client because of some personal or financial relationship that exists. Conflicts can exist in various situations. Paralegals are held to the same ethical duty as attorneys.
